Organic Coconut Oil

I know!

This is exciting, right?!

It’s a big moment and I feel like I must share it with all you beautiful people in Buenos Aires!!

Yesterday a bottle of Organic Virgin Coconut Oil was purchased on Soler and Julian Alvarez at Granomadre in Palermo.

Yes, the price is insane at 300 pesos a bottle and that’s totally bonkers but hey, maybe you can afford it or surprise a special someone with the upcoming holidays.

If you’re wondering what to use it for, just replace it with vegetable or olive oil, should work fine in most recipes.  Or give your hair and skin a nutritious rub down that will transport you to the beach in no time.
